Anyconnect Update - Some PC's just break

I'm trying to troubleshoot a problem, where I roll out a new anyconnect version as the webdeploy package. Basically, loads of machines work when they reconnect to the anyconnect VPN, i.e. it connects, the update runs, and then it connects to the VPN. However, every freeking update I do, it seems I get about 50 laptops that always have an issue. When I have a look at them, the anyconnect software has been completely uninstalled, and when I get them to download the latest image from my webdeploy URL, it downloads, but the installation fails with the error "There is a problem with this windows installer package. A program run as part of the setup did not finish as expeceted."

The workaround I've been using is to completely uninstall the remaining package on there which seems to be the DART install. Then reboot. Then the downloaded anyconnect file will install properly. It's very unclear what the issue is, and I'm wondering if anyone gets this problem, and how you resolved it.
